Understanding Bail Basics



Bail functions as a vital mechanism within the criminal justice system, allowing individuals accused of a criminal activity to safeguard their release from guardianship while awaiting test. This procedure is necessary for keeping the presumption of innocence, which is a basic concept of justice. When a person is jailed, a judge usually determines the bail amount based on different elements, consisting of the severity of the supposed criminal offense, the person's criminal history, and their connections to the neighborhood.


The bail quantity can be paid completely, usually in cash money, or via a bail bond, which entails a third celebration ensuring the settlement to the court in situation the charged falls short to show up. Additionally, the bail system offers to guarantee that defendants return for their court days, thus reducing the risk of trip. If an accused fails to show up, the bail may be waived, and a warrant may be provided for their apprehension.


Understanding the nuances of bail is necessary for people navigating the lawful system. It empowers them to make educated choices concerning their alternatives for launch and highlights the relevance of conformity with court orders during the pre-trial phase.


The Role of Bail Bondsmen



When individuals are not able to pay the complete bail quantity set by the court, bondsman play a vital duty in promoting their release. These professionals serve as intermediaries in between offenders and the judicial system, offering the needed monetary aid to secure a bail bond. By charging a non-refundable cost, normally a percent of the overall bail amount, bail bondsmen think the threat of covering the complete bail if the accused stops working to show up in court.


Bail bondsmen conduct comprehensive analyses of prospective customers, evaluating their financial stability, the nature of the fees, and their probability of showing up in court. Kinds Of Bail Bonds



There are numerous kinds of bail bonds readily available, each created to satisfy specific circumstances and needs of offenders (bail bonds Vista). The most usual kind is the guaranty bond, which entails a bondsman that assures the complete bail amount to the court in exchange for a charge, normally around 10% of the overall bail. This plan allows individuals that can not afford the complete bail total up to secure their release


Another type is the money bond, where the defendant or a third celebration pays the full bail quantity in money directly to the court. Upon the final thought of the instance, the funds are returned, minus any kind of court fees.


Property bonds use realty as security his response for the bail. The court places blog here a lien on the home, making certain that if the offender fails to show up, the court can take the residential or commercial property to cover the bail quantity.


Lastly, federal bonds are specifically for government situations and commonly need specific understanding from the bondsman. Each kind of bail bond serves various functions, and recognizing these differences is important for defendants browsing the bail process.

Expenses and Settlement Choices



While browsing the bail procedure, it is important to consider the linked costs and offered settlement choices. The main cost when protecting a bail bond is the premium, commonly set at a percentage of the overall bail quantity, typically ranging from 10% to 15%. Bail bonds Oceanside. This premium is non-refundable and is billed for the solution provided by the bondsman






In enhancement to the costs, there might be various other costs, such as management charges, collateral needs, or prices for extra services like traveling or documents. Comprehending these prospective expenditures upfront can aid avoid surprises later while doing so.


Pertaining to payment choices, several bail bondsmen use flexible arrangements to fit various financial situations. Common payment approaches include cash, credit history cards, and settlement plans, which enable customers to pay the premium in installments. Some firms may also accept security, such as residential property or vehicles, to Learn More Here protect the bond.




It is suggested to review all readily available options with the bondsman, as they can offer guidance tailored to your details scenarios. By being notified regarding the costs and settlement techniques, individuals can make better choices during this tough time.
